They ensure that people are treated as equals, that people get the dignity and respect they deserve and that their differences are celebrated. In health and social care settings there are policies and procedures that promote inclusive practice and challenge discrimination, they promote rights, empower individuals and remove any barriers restricting them. Nearly two years after the COVID-19 pandemic began in the United States, Gen Zers, ranging from middle school students to early professionals, are reporting higher rates of anxiety, depression, and distress than any other age group. These include the human rights act 1998, the disability discrimination act 2005, Special educational needs and disability act 2001, Race relations (Amendment) act 2000, The equality act 2010, and the European convention on human rights. In a recent issue of the journal Health & Social Work, published by NASW Press, Wayne Ambrose-Miller, PhD, and Rachelle Ashcroft, PhD, published a study of social workers experiences in interprofessional collaboration. In our sample, Gen Z respondents were more likely to report having been diagnosed with a behavioral-health condition (for example, mental or substance use disorder) than either Gen Xers or baby boomers.
